Roof flashing services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of metal strips that are strategically placed around roof joints, chimneys, vents, skylights, and other roof penetrations. These metal components serve as a barrier to prevent water from seeping into the underlying structure. Proper flashing ensures that areas where the roof intersects with other building elements remain watertight, protecting the property from potential water damage. Contractors skilled in flashing services assess existing flashings for deterioration and make necessary adjustments or upgrades to maintain the roof’s integrity.

These services are essential in addressing common roofing issues such as leaks, water intrusion, and structural damage caused by improper or aging flashing.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ause flashing materials to corrode, crack, or shift, leading to vulnerabilities in the roof’s waterproofing system. Timely repairs or replacements help prevent water from entering the attic or interior spaces, which can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and other costly damages. Regular maintenance and professional flashing services are key to extending the lifespan of a roof and maintaining a property’s overall condition.

Cost Range - Roof flashing services typically cost between $200 and $600 for standard repairs or replacements. For larger or more complex projects, prices can reach up to $1,200 or more, depending on the scope. Example costs often vary based on roof size and material type.

Material Expenses - The price of materials for roof flashing, such as aluminum or copper, generally ranges from $10 to $30 per linear foot. Higher-end materials like copper tend to be more expensive, influencing overall service costs. Local pros often include material costs in their estimates.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for roof flashing services us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or expense depends on the project's complexity and the number of flashing sections needed. Some contractors may charge a flat rate for simple repairs.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may apply for removing old flashing or addressing underlying roof issues, typically adding $100 to $300. These charges vary based on the condition of the existing roof and the extent of repairs required.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ing and why is it important? Roof flashing is a material installed around roof features to prevent water infiltration and protect the structure from leaks and damage.

When should roof flashing be replaced or repaired? Roof flashing should be inspected regularly and replaced or repaired if it shows signs of rust, damage, or leaks.

What types of materials are used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for durability and weather resistance.

Can roof flashing be installed on any type of roof? Most roof types can accommodate flashing, but the suitability depends on the roof’s design and materials; a professional can assess compatibility.
